National Grid Collapse Causes Nationwide Power Outage

Nigeria experienced a nationwide power outage as the National grid collapsed, leading to Distribution Companies (DisCos) having less than 200 megawatts to allocate to customers. The collapse resulted in a significant drop in the distribution load profile, affecting major cities like Lagos, Abuja, and Port Harcourt.
Electricity companies, including the Transmission Company of Nigeria (TCN) and Port Harcourt Electricity Distribution Company (PHED), took to social media to explain the outage and assure customers of restoration efforts.
